Some coal operations need continuous ash monitoring but prefer a system that does not require a radioactive source. COALSCAN 1500 uses natural gamma detection to monitor ash content in suitable coal applications, supporting mine grade control, plant feed monitoring, product quality and blending decisions.

COALSCAN 1500 uses Natural Gamma Ray Detection to measure gamma radiation associated with naturally occurring potassium, thorium and uranium in ash-forming minerals. The approach provides continuous ash measurement without using a radioactive source.
